Senior Temporary Works Engineer (Senior Technical Manager)

Location: Flexible (Must be based in England and be happy to travel)

Hybrid Working: 3 days office/site, 2 days home-based

At Octavius Infrastructure, we deliver safe, sustainable and efficient transport solutions across the UK. As our portfolio of highways and civil engineering projects continues to grow, we are looking for a Chartered Senior Technical Manager (CEng) to provide technical leadership across our Highways and Regional Civil Engineering sectors.

This is a key role within the business, combining technical expertise, temporary works leadership, engineering assurance and people development. Working across multiple projects and frameworks, you will help shape engineering solutions from tender stage through to delivery, ensuring they are safe, practical, buildable and commercially effective.

What You'll Be Doing

As Senior Technical Manager, you'll support projects across both our Highways and Regional Civil Engineering sectors, providing practical engineering leadership throughout the project lifecycle. You'll:

  • Provide technical leadership and engineering expertise across a diverse portfolio of projects and bids.
  • Develop, review and challenge temporary works solutions and construction methodologies.
  • Act as a technical authority, supporting project teams with complex engineering, buildability and delivery challenges.
  • Undertake technical reviews and independent design checks, ensuring solutions are safe, efficient and fit for purpose.
  • Support the management of technical risk and engineering assurance across multiple projects.
  • Contribute to tender submissions, delivery strategies and early contractor involvement activities.
  • Mentor, coach and develop Temporary Works Coordinators, Temporary Works Design Engineers and emerging technical leaders.
  • Lead and support a small team, helping build engineering capability across the business.
  • Collaborate with project teams, designers, clients and supply chain partners to achieve successful project outcomes.
  • Champion engineering innovation, knowledge sharing and continuous improvement across the organisation.

What We're Looking For

We are seeking an experienced civil or structural engineer with strong technical capability, practical engineering judgement and a passion for developing others. You'll have:

  • A degree, or equivalent qualification, in Civil Engineering or a related discipline.
  • Chartered Engineer (CEng) status. (ICE or IStructE)
  • Significant experience within civil engineering and construction environments.
  • Strong temporary works design knowledge and experience of reviewing, checking or assuring engineering solutions.
  • A thorough understanding of construction engineering, buildability, construction sequencing and risk management.
  • Experience supporting project delivery and developing practical, cost-effective engineering solutions.
  • The ability to coach, mentor and develop engineers at varying stages of their careers.
  • Experience leading teams (preferred)
  • Experience contributing to technical governance and assurance.
  • Strong communication and stakeholder management skills.
  • Experience working for a major contractor within highways, rail or civil engineering sectors.
  • A willingness to travel regularly to projects and offices across the UK.
